Very slow to connect using PHP Toolkit

We are using the PHP Toolkit to pull data out of netsuite to display on our site.  In particular we are running some saved searches and displaying the results on our site.

Yesterday this started running really slowly.  After a bit of investigating it appears that the following line is to blame

[CODE]$nsc->setPassport(self::$_nsEmail, self::$_nsPassword, self::$_companyId, self::$_nsRole);[/CODE]

Where $nsc is our nsClient instance.  This has been running without problem since March however now it is taking up to 45 seconds to execute this line.

Prior to March, we had a similar issue that was resolved by updating the version of the PHP toolkit to 2010.2.  Since we are due to be 'upgraded' again soon, I suspect that this is to blame however I can't see a 2011.1 toolkit available for download.
